Output e28db66152b11f80ddf3085038be9b7323197329168e5c2f7f7f38d8ef06bf19:0

value
69449025
script pubkey
OP_0 OP_PUSHBYTES_20 5a7142d7bfcb5fcf017930932f269527ba143a60
address
ltc1qtfc594aled0u7qtexzfj7f54y7apgwnqupaa0s
transaction
e28db66152b11f80ddf3085038be9b7323197329168e5c2f7f7f38d8ef06bf19
spent
true